Meteora Capital's APGB Position: Q4 2023 in Review

Meteora Capital sold out of Apollo Strategic Growth Capital II (APGB) in Q4 2023, closing a stake of 332,603 shares — an estimated $3.5M sold.

Meteora Capital first reported a position in APGB in Q1 2022 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$16.5M in Q1 2023. 0 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old APGB as of Q4 2023.
